All Violations (10)

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102417(g)(1)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that the licensee could not provide proof of annual purachase of fire extinguisher or prrof of service which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ee is required to provide proof of newly purchased fire extinguisher or proof of service by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

CRITICALHEALTHCCR 102370(d)(1)Type AOct 27, 2022

Based on observation, interview, and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that two (2) adults living in the home are not fingerprint cleared, which poses an immediate health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: LIcensee is advised the two (2) indiviudals with no live scan must submit fingerprints for livescan no later than 10/31/22.

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102417(b)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that the children's daycar area had excessive cluttered with high piles of children items, which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ee was advised to remove the high piles of children's items in the living room, remove sharps from being accessible to chidlren and add a lock to the laundry room to make it inacessible and submit proof via email by 11/3/22 to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102417(g)(4)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that sharps were accessible and within chidren's reach, hazardous items were accessible throughout the home and outdoor yard (sharps, spikes and chemicas in the outdoor yard, which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will ensure that all items that could pose a danger to chidlren in care are inacessible and off-limits. Licensee will submit pictures proving these items are inacessible by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102417(g)(9)(A)1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that the lasst documented drill was conducted on 4/14/22 which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ee is required to conduct a fire/emergency drill and submit proof by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Veaz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102425(j)(1)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that Infant Safe Sleep 15 mintue checks are not being conducted which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will start to document Infant Safe Sleep 15 mintue checks with all children under the age of 2 years old and will submit proof by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HHSC 1596.8662(b)(1)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that three (3) assistants that directly work with the children did not have a valid AB1207 which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will ensure all assistant's directly working with chidlren have completed the AB1207 certificate. Licensee will sbumit proof of completed certificates by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ca.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102416.1(a)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in there were no personnel files to review during inspection which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will create personnel files for all adults that works directly with the children and submit proof by 11/3/2022 via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HHSC 1597.622(a)(1)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that Licensee and Assistants did not have proof of immunizations which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will collect proof of immunizations for all adults working directly with the children and submit proof by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ov

SERIOUSHEALTHCCR 102417(g)(8)Type BOct 27, 2022

Based on observation and record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in the Licensee does not have a roster for the facility which poses/pos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.

Resolution: Licensee will create facility roster and submit proof by 11/3/2022 via email to Francisca.Velazquez@dss.ca.gov
